Recognizing the Telltale Signs of Mold Growth
When it comes to mold growth, there are several key signs to watch out for in your home. One of the most common indicators is the presence of a musty odor, which often signifies the presence of hidden mold. Additionally, visible discoloration or water stains on walls or ceilings can be a clear indication of mold growth. It’s important to also be on the lookout for any peeling or bubbling paint, warped wood, or wet carpeting or flooring, as these can all be signs of a mold issue. If you notice any of these telltale signs in your home, it’s crucial to take action promptly to prevent further spread and ensure the health and safety of your household.

What are common signs of mold growth in a property?
Some common signs of mold growth in a property include musty odors, visible mold growth on surfaces, water st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ings, and allergic reactions such as sneezing and coughing.
How can I identify mold-related health symptoms in residents of a building?
The key to identifying mold-related health symptoms in residents of a building is to look for common signs such as respiratory issues, allergies, skin irritation, and headaches that may worsen when spending time in certain areas of the building. It’s important to consult with a healthcare professional if you suspect mold exposure.
Are there specific indicators that suggest the presence of hidden mold in a structure?
Musty odor, water stains, humidity issues, and allergic reactions are specific indicators that suggest the presence of hidden mold in a structure.
